The format is based on [Keep a Changelog](https://keepachangelog.com/en/1.0.0/), and this project adheres to [Semantic Versioning](https://semver.org/spec/v2.0.0.html) with the `0.MAJOR.PATCH` extension. ## [Unreleased] ## [0.2.0] - 2019-10-10 ### Added - `conformance::tests` now takes an optional third path argument, `value`, a path to some generic de/serializable object (e.g. [`serde_json::Value`](https://docs.serde.rs/serde_json/enum.Value.html)). If `value` is provided, the function return value does not have to implement `Deserialize`. - `conformance::tests` now optionally takes a shortcut argument `serde` before `ser`, `de`, and `value`. If present, `serde` defaults the values of `ser`, `de`, and `value` to `serde::to_string`, `serde::from_str`, and `serde::value`, respectively. `ser`, `de`, and `value` may still appear afterwards to override said defaults. Example: `serde=serde_json, ser=serde_json::to_string_pretty` will use `serde_json` to test, as the prettified JSON rather than minified. ## 0.1.0 - 2019-10-4 Initial release. ### Added - `conformance::tests` attribute macro - arguments: `(exact, ser = $path, de = $path, file = "file/path")` - apply to: function declaration returning some `impl Serialize + Deserialize` [Unreleased]: [0.2.0]:
